Jump to content

Widget:FryasFontPicker

From Oera Linda Wiki
Revision as of 09:34, 2 June 2023 by Pax (talk | contribs) (Created page with "<select id="fryas_font_picker"> <option value="latin">Latin</option> <option value="standskrift">Standskrift</option> <option value="wagumskrift">Wagumskrift</option> </select> <script> var lang_picker = document.getElementById("fryas_font_picker"); lang_picker.addEventListener((event) => { switch (lang_picker.value) { case "latin": lang_picker.classList.remove("standskrift"); lang_picker.classList.remove("wagumskrift"); break; case "sta...")
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)

<select id="fryas_font_picker">

 <option value="latin">Latin</option>
 <option value="standskrift">Standskrift</option>
 <option value="wagumskrift">Wagumskrift</option>

</select> <script> var lang_picker = document.getElementById("fryas_font_picker"); lang_picker.addEventListener((event) => {

 switch (lang_picker.value) {
   case "latin":
     lang_picker.classList.remove("standskrift");
     lang_picker.classList.remove("wagumskrift");
     break;
   case "standskrift":
     lang_picker.classList.add("standskrift");
     lang_picker.classList.remove("wagumskrift");
     break;
   case "wagumskrift":
     lang_picker.classList.remove("standskrift");
     lang_picker.classList.add("wagumskrift");
     break;
 }
 localStorage.setItem("preferred_fryas_font", lang_picker.value);

}); var pref_font = localStorage.getItem("preferred_fryas_font") if (pref_font != null) {

 lang_picker.value = pref_font;

} </script>